Chemical Storage Containers
Chemical storage containers are ideal for storage and transporting bulk chemicals and materials, both hazardous and non-hazardous. They are strong and resistant to punctures and impacts.
Keep water reactive chemicals safe from acidic oxidizers, away from bases, and flammable liquids away from organic solvents. Also, separate gases into their own storage area (oxidizing gas cylinders from flammable gas). Keep compressed gas cylinders away from sources of heat.

With a standard base dimension of 42" x 48", IBC tanks have the capacity of being stacked over one another which maximizes storage space. This space-saving design helps reduce costs by reducing the floor space of warehouses and transportation vehicles.
IBCs made of stainless steel can be customized by using different fittings such as lids, valves and liners, depending on the requirements of your business. This is particularly beneficial for companies that have specialized processes or work setups that require specific equipment to ensure the safe handling of materials and products.
The standard stainless steel IBC tank is constructed with a heavy-duty 10 gauge 304 grade steel shell, 2'' slopped bottoms to facilitate drainage and virtually eliminate heel (cargo residual), a 2'' ball valve made of 316 stainless steel, manway opening 22 inches with EPDM gasket, and an 3" Rieke or a fusible pressure relief vent. On request, custom-designed options like camlock quick connect couplings, off-set valves with angled edges and other options that are custom-designed can be designed to meet your particular requirements.
The tank's inner part has a sloping bottom and a standard 2" bung. This enables quick and efficient cleaning draining, refilling and filling. A slanted lid is included for easy access and to safeguard the contents of the tank. The standard IBC comes with a mix of stacking lugs and lifting lugs and leg positioning devices that provide access to pallet jacks and forklifts. Insulation blankets of custom sizes are available on request to improve temperature maintenance and protection of corrosive and temperature-sensitive cargo.
Polyethylene IBC Tote
The plastic IBC tote comes with many benefits. It can be used to store and transport diverse substances such as liquids, dry chemicals, powders, and granular materials. These containers are also designed to reduce the risk of contamination by preventing air and moisture from reaching the contents. This reduces product degradation and also saves businesses money. The design of IBC totes also allows for easy access via a built in valve or nozzle.
The IBC tote can be easily cleaned, which is important when it comes to containers containing potentially dangerous substances or foods. They can be cleaned and sterilized using a steamer or pressure washer. Additionally the container's construction is strong enough to withstand harsh environmental conditions.
IBC totes come in a variety of sizes, materials and designs, based on the purpose for which they are used. The rigid plastic IBC totes come in high-density polyethylene that is safe for numerous applications and materials. These containers are available in a range of capacities which range from 275 up to 332 US gallons. They can also be double-stacked for transport. Galvanized steel caged IBC totes are a different option for industrial applications and are made of carbon steel and a galvanized coating to guard against corrosion.
Caged IBC totes are used to store and transport hazardous and non-hazardous chemicals, along with beverages and food products. They can be stack up to four inches high, and they have a drain valve built-in that reduces the amount of residual product left behind after emptying. This can save space in warehouses and distribution centers and make them easier to manage.

Polyethylene Spill Tray
A polyethylene spill tray can be used to store small Modular Buildings Containers of chemicals. They keep liquids from escape during liquid transfer and settling on the floor of the workplace or polluting the surrounding. They can be easily stacked and stored in chemical storage areas to increase safety and hygiene.
Spill trays come in different sizes and capacities to accommodate the dimensions and types of liquids you handle at your workplace. They are small and sturdy and can be used to contain leaks and spills that might occur during industrial processes. They can be used to collect spills and drips that result from chemical bottles, fuel containers, jerrycans, or oil drums.
Take into consideration the materials and other aspects when selecting the best spill tray for your workplace. You must also consider whether the liquids that are handled at your workplace is corrosive or volatile. This will ensure that your workplace is in compliance with regulations and protect employees and the environment from exposure to dangerous substances.
Other tools, like absorbent mats and gas bottle cages, may help reduce environmental damage and contamination. They are especially helpful when handling flammable, toxic or toxic liquids. These tools, when paired with a spill reaction strategy that is comprehensive, can assist in creating an environment that is safe and healthy for your employees. environment.
Depending on the type of liquid being handled, your workplace could require additional tools for responding to spills such as spill kits or chemical storage cabinets. Implementing these tools along with a spill control strategy can reduce the chance of accidents in the workplace.
